Product Description:

Part of the PB SANMOTION Servo Motors family, the Sanyo Denki PBM604DXC20 is a servo motor. Its tiny, economical form makes it ideal for uses requiring precision in limited areas. This gadget has a motor size of 60 millimeters square and a length of 102.3 millimeters; its maximum stall torque is 1.9 Newton-meters and rotor inertia is 0.84 kilograms per square meter. Running on a 24/48 VDC ±10% power supply, this device is ideal for low-voltage, high-precision systems without any restrictions. The motor can handle both incremental (INC-E) and absolute (ABS-E, ABS-R II) encoder systems requiring cable lengths of up to 30 meters.

Using low-resistance cables or an increased wire count arrangement, it can also handle wiring lengths of up to 50 meters. Other features include flexible command input modes that may be customized to fit the needs of many control applications, battery connection terminal for absolute encoders, current limit and overtravel settings. Furthermore, the monitor output capabilities let users choose certain signals and output ranges, which might enhance the system's diagnostics and feedback functions. The PBM604DXC20 is a great choice for space-sensitive and precision-driven automation applications as it combines a tiny size, great control features, and a robust design.

Allowable Radial Load
167 N
Allowable Thrust Load
14.7 N
Compatible Driver Model Number
PB3D003M200
Max Operating Altitude
≤1000 m above sea level
Motor Dimensions
60×60 mm
Motor Length
102.3 mm
Motor Mass
1.42 kg
Operating Temperature
0°C to +55°C
Rotor Inertia
0.84 kg·m²
Set Model Number
PBDM604
Stall Torque (Max)
1.9 Nm
Storage Temperature
-20°C to +65°C
Supply Voltage
24/48 VDC ±10%
Vibration Acceleration
5 m/s²
Vibration Duration
2 hr per axis
Vibration Frequency
10–55 Hz
